社区
数据库及相关技术
帖子详情
数据库连接是否应该有多个?
Jonix
2012-05-31 09:04:27
我在C/S架构下,在Server端通过ADO连接到SQLServer服务器。
不管客户端有多少个点,实际上从Server到SQLServer的连接一直只有一个。
一直发现当客户端同时登录的用户超过5个以上时,运行速度就很慢,
想了很久,怀疑是由于TADOConnection只有一个的原因。
因为C#虽然也是只用一个,但它内部是自动创建了几十个连接的模式。
不知道大家是否碰到过相同的问题,如何解决的?
...全文
38
回复
打赏
收藏
数据库连接是否应该有多个?
我在C/S架构下,在Server端通过ADO连接到SQLServer服务器。 不管客户端有多少个点,实际上从Server到SQLServer的连接一直只有一个。 一直发现当客户端同时登录的用户超过5个以上时,运行速度就很慢, 想了很久,怀疑是由于TADOConnection只有一个的原因。 因为C#虽然也是只用一个,但它内部是自动创建了几十个连接的模式。 不知道大家是否碰到过相同的问题,如何解决的?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
Java源码系列-手写
数据库连接
池(附源码)
为了理解
数据库连接
池的底层原理,我们可以自己手写一个类似Hikari,Druid一样的高性能的
数据库连接
池!通过手写
数据库连接
池掌握
数据库连接
池底层运行原理,胜任企业级开发、提高编程内功!!!
数据库连接
池在...
数据库连接
池大小到底多少合适?
一、前言 基本上来说,大部分项目都需要跟数据库做交互,那么,
数据库连接
池的大小设置成多大合适呢? 一些开发老鸟可能还会告诉你:没关系,尽量设置的大些,比如设置成 200,这样数据库性能会高些,吞吐量也会大些! 你也许会点头称是,真的是这样吗?看完这篇文章,也许会颠覆你的认知哦! 二、正菜开始 可以很直接的说,关于
数据库连接
池大小的设置,每个开发者都可能在一环节掉进坑里,事实上呢,大部分程序员可能都会依靠自己的直觉去设置它的大小,设置成 100 ?思量许久后,自顾自想,
应该
差不多吧? 三、假设你的服务有1万并
数据库连接
数和
数据库连接
池的连接数区别?
1、
数据库连接
数,也就是一个数据库,最多能够同时 接受 多少个 客户的连接. 2、在没有
数据库连接
池 的情况下, 一个客户,每次访问, 就要创建一个
数据库连接
, 执行 SQL, 获取结果, 然后关闭、释放掉
数据库连接
,问题就在于创建一个
数据库连接
, 是一个很消耗资源,花费很多时间的操作,于是
数据库连接
池产生了。 3、
数据库连接
池 预先打开一定数量的
数据库连接
, 并维持着连接。 4
数据库连接
池性能优化,连接数到底
应该
设置多大?
文章目录1.
数据库连接
数测试2. 透过现象看原理3. 如何合理设置
数据库连接
数 1.
数据库连接
数测试 假如你有一个网站,压力有个1万上下的并发访问——也就是说差不多2万左右的TPS。那么这个网站的
数据库连接
池
应该
设置成多大呢?可能更正确的问法是:这个网站的
数据库连接
池
应该
设置成多小呢?下面请看一下这个测试视频http://www.dailymotion.com/video/x2s8uec,(视频是英文解说且
为什么要使用
数据库连接
池,每次连接都关闭,数据库默认100条连接?
疑惑 1、使用
数据库连接
池有什么好处? 2、我关闭
数据库连接
,即使不是立即回收,100个连接也够了? 3、我用了
数据库连接
池,为什么还是不管用? 解惑 第一个问题 假设设置
数据库连接
池最小连接数是13 1、
数据库连接
池就是开13个线程连接数据库;(13个连接不会关闭,除非程序关了) 2、在执行对数据库操作中使用连接池里的连接,用完只要关闭连接,就等于把连接还回池子里面; 3、池子...
数据库及相关技术
1,178
社区成员
18,939
社区内容
发帖
与我相关
我的任务
数据库及相关技术
C++ Builder 数据库及相关技术
复制链接
扫一扫
分享
社区描述
C++ Builder 数据库及相关技术
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章